Gustation
Gustation is the sense of taste, a chemical sense controlled by taste buds in the mouth that interact with various substances.
Difference Threshold
The minimum amount of change needed in a stimulus for the difference to be noticeable.
Weber's Law
A principle stating that the smallest noticeable difference in stimulus intensity is a constant proportion of the intensity of the initial stimulus.
Sensory Adaptation
The mechanism in which sense receptors reduce their responsiveness to steady stimuli over a period, helping organisms to pay attention to alterations in their surroundings.
